运行到手机或模拟器 运行到Android App基座 没有检测到设备?

本文提供了在VivoX30手机上解决无法检测到设备问题的方法,包括进入开发者选项,设置默认USB为MIDI模式,然后刷新以找到设备。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

什么都配置了还是没有检测到设备,请插入设备后点击刷新再试。

下面是小编尝试了各种方法后的解决方法(手机vivo X30)

1.在开发者选项中找到默认USB设置 点击进入

2.点击选择MIDI,

选择完后再 刷新 即可  就可以找到你的设备

如下图:

<think>我们正在讨论如何通过HBuilderX制作自定义调试基座来解决原生插件未包含的问题。用户提供了命令行示例,我们需要详细说明制作自定义基座的步骤和注意事项。 根据用户的问题,我们需要回答如何正确制作自定义调试基座,特别是针对Android平台。同时,我们需要在最后提出3-5个相关问题。 回答结构: 1. 解释命令行参数 2. 详细步骤(包括图形界面和命令行两种方式) 3. 注意事项 4. 验证方法 然后提出相关问题。 注意:必须使用中文,且最后以“§§相关问题§§”开头的问题列表结束。</think>### HBuilderX 制作自定义调试基座的完整指南 #### 命令行操作详解 您提供的命令: ```bash hbuilder custom --platform android --packagename com.example.app ``` 这是通过**命令行**创建自定义基座的方式,参数说明: - `--platform android`:指定 Android 平台 - `--packagename com.example.app`:设置应用包名(需替换为您的实际包名) --- #### 完整操作流程(图形界面+命令行) ##### 方法1:HBuilderX 图形界面操作(推荐) 1. **打开菜单**:运行运行手机模拟器 → 制作自定义调试基座 2. **配置参数**: - 选择平台:Android/iOS - 设置包名(如 `com.yourcompany.app`) - 配置证书(iOS需开发者账号) 3. **开始制作**:点击"打包"按钮等待完成 ##### 方法2:命令行高级操作 ```bash # 完整命令格式 hbuilder custom --platform [android|ios] --packagename [your.package.name] --certificate [cert_path] --profile [provisioning_profile] # 实际示例(Android) hbuilder custom --platform android --packagename com.company.app --keystore release.keystore --storepassword 123456 --alias mykey # iOS示例(需真机证书) hbuilder custom --platform ios --packagename com.company.app --certificate "iPhone Developer: Name (ID)" --profile "iOS_Distribution_Profile" ``` --- #### 关键参数说明 | 参数 | 必填 | 说明 | 示例值 | |------|------|------|--------| | `--platform` | 是 | 目标平台 | `android` `ios` | | `--packagename` | 是 | 应用包名 | `com.example.app` | | `--keystore` | Android需 | 签名文件路径 | `android.keystore` | | `--storepassword` | Android需 | 密钥库密码 | `your_password` | | `--alias` | Android需 | 密钥别名 | `release_key` | | `--certificate` | iOS需 | 开发者证书名称 | `iPhone Developer: Tom (AB123CDE45F)` | | `--profile` | iOS需 | 描述文件名称 | `iOS_Team_Provisioning` | --- #### 注意事项 1. **包名规则**: - 必须全小写字母 - 格式:`com.公司名.应用名` - 一旦确定不能更改 2. **文件路径问题**: ```bash # 正确:使用相对路径绝对路径 --keystore ../certs/android.keystore ``` 3. **常见错误处理**: - **"证书无效"** → 检查证书是否过期 - **"包名冲突"** → 卸载手机上的旧版本 - **"文件未找到"** → 使用绝对路径`/User/name/certs/file.keystore` 4. **生成位置**: - Windows:`C:\Users\[用户名]\AppData\Roaming\HBuilder\custom` - macOS:`/Users/[用户名]/Library/HBuilder/custom` --- #### 验证是否成功 1. 安装到设备后检查: ```javascript // 在App.vue中检测 mounted() { console.log(plus.runtime.appid === 'HBuilder'); // 自定义基座返回false console.log(plus.runtime.versionCode); // 显示自定义基座版本 } ``` 2. 查看控制台日志: ``` [CustomBase] 自定义调试基座(com.example.app)安装成功 ```
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值